PG电子APP开发,从概念到落地实践pg电子APP开发

PG电子APP开发,从概念到落地实践pg电子APP开发,

本文目录导读:

  1. PG电子APP的概念与特点
  2. PG电子APP的开发流程
  3. PG电子APP的技术实现
  4. PG电子APP的落地实践
  5. PG电子APP的未来趋势

随着移动互联网的快速发展,PG(Progressive Graphics)游戏作为一种高画质、高质量的游戏形式,正在逐渐成为玩家关注的焦点,而PG电子APP开发作为实现PG游戏的重要手段,也在不断受到开发者和玩家的青睐,本文将从PG电子APP的概念、开发流程、技术实现以及落地实践等方面,深入探讨PG电子APP开发的全貌。

PG电子APP的概念与特点

PG电子APP是一种基于电子设备(如手机、平板电脑等)运行的高画质游戏应用,与传统PC游戏相比,PG电子APP在画面表现、互动体验和叙事深度上都有显著提升,以下是PG电子APP的一些关键特点:

  1. 高画质与细腻画面:PG电子APP通常采用高质量的图形渲染技术,例如光线追踪、阴影效果和高动态范围(HDR)等,使得游戏画面更加逼真细腻。

  2. 沉浸式体验:PG电子APP注重玩家的沉浸感,通过精妙的场景设计、流畅的动画效果和丰富的音效系统,提升玩家的游戏体验。

  3. 多平台支持:PG电子APP通常支持多种设备和平台(如iOS、Android等),使玩家能够随时随地享受游戏。

  4. 社交互动:许多PG电子APP支持玩家之间的互动,例如联机战斗、多人合作等,增强了游戏的社交属性。

  5. 叙事与剧情:PG电子APP通常包含丰富的故事线和剧情,通过玩家的选择和行动影响游戏的进程和结局,增强游戏的代入感和吸引力。

PG电子APP的开发流程

PG电子APP的开发流程大致可以分为以下几个阶段:

需求分析与设计

在开发之前,需要对PG电子APP的功能、画质、平台支持、用户需求等进行全面分析,这包括:

  • 功能需求:确定游戏的基本功能,如角色移动、攻击、战斗系统等。
  • 画质需求:根据目标平台的屏幕分辨率和硬件性能,确定游戏的画质标准。
  • 用户需求:通过市场调研和玩家测试,了解玩家的期望和反馈。
  • 技术需求:确定开发所需的硬件和软件技术,如游戏引擎、渲染技术等。

副本设计与建模

副本设计是PG电子APP开发的重要环节,主要涉及以下内容:

  • 角色建模:为游戏角色创建三维模型,包括角色的外观、动作和表情。
  • 场景建模:为游戏场景创建三维模型,包括战斗场景、地图、道具等。
  • 光照与材质:通过光线追踪和材质渲染技术,提升场景的细节表现。

游戏引擎与技术实现

PG电子APP的开发通常基于专业的游戏引擎,如Unity或Unreal Engine,以下是技术实现的关键步骤:

  • 游戏引擎选择:根据项目需求和开发团队的技术能力,选择合适的引擎。
  • 场景导入与优化:导入3D模型和场景,进行场景优化以提升运行效率。
  • 物理引擎配置:配置物理引擎,实现角色的移动、碰撞检测等功能。
  • 渲染技术应用:应用光线追踪、阴影效果等技术,提升画面质量。

功能实现与测试

在实现基本功能后,需要进行功能测试和性能测试:

  • 功能测试:确保游戏的基本功能正常运行,包括角色移动、攻击、战斗等。
  • 性能测试:测试游戏的运行效率,确保在不同设备和分辨率下都能流畅运行。
  • 用户反馈收集:通过用户测试和反馈,不断优化游戏功能和体验。

发布与维护

游戏发布是开发流程的最后一步,包括:

  • 应用商店优化:优化游戏在应用商店的描述、截图、评分等信息,提高游戏的可见度。
  • 版本更新:根据玩家反馈和市场变化,定期更新游戏,修复问题,增加新内容。

PG电子APP的技术实现

PG电子APP的技术实现涉及多个方面,以下是其中的关键技术点:

游戏引擎的选择与应用

PG电子APP通常使用基于C++或C#的高性能游戏引擎,如Unity或Unreal Engine,以下是使用这些引擎的一些关键点:

  • 脚本系统:利用脚本系统实现复杂的功能,如AI行为、事件驱动等。
  • 插件与扩展:通过插件和扩展扩展游戏的功能,如增加新角色、道具或场景。
  • 物理引擎:利用物理引擎实现角色的移动、碰撞检测等功能,提升游戏的真实感。

渲染技术的应用

为了实现高画质的渲染效果,PG电子APP需要应用以下技术:

  • 光线追踪:通过光线追踪技术,实现逼真的阴影、深度渲染等效果。
  • 阴影效果:通过阴影效果提升场景的细节表现,增强游戏的视觉效果。
  • HDR 技术:通过HDR技术提升画面的动态范围,展现更丰富的色彩和细节。

游戏优化

游戏优化是确保PG电子APP在多设备和多平台上流畅运行的关键:

  • 性能优化:通过优化代码和配置,提升游戏的运行效率。
  • 内存管理:优化内存管理,减少内存占用,提升游戏的运行速度。
  • 缓存管理:优化缓存管理,减少缓存击中率,提升游戏的运行效率。

PG电子APP的落地实践

PG电子APP的开发不仅是一项技术工作,更是一项需要结合市场和用户反馈的实践过程,以下是PG电子APP落地的几个关键点:

与平台的适配

PG电子APP需要在不同的平台上进行适配,包括:

  • iOS适配:针对iOS平台,优化游戏的运行效率和用户体验。
  • Android适配:针对Android平台,优化游戏的运行效率和用户体验。
  • 跨平台开发:通过跨平台开发技术,使游戏能够在多个平台上无缝运行。

游戏营销与推广

游戏营销与推广是确保PG电子APP成功发行的重要环节,包括:

  • 宣传推广:通过社交媒体、游戏论坛、视频平台等渠道宣传游戏。
  • 限时活动:通过限时活动、折扣优惠等方式吸引玩家。
  • 玩家社区建设:通过建立玩家社区,增强玩家的归属感和互动性。

游戏更新与迭代

PG电子APP需要不断更新和迭代,以满足玩家的需求和市场变化,以下是更新和迭代的关键点:

  • 功能更新:根据玩家反馈和市场趋势,增加新的游戏功能。
  • 画面优化:通过优化画面效果,提升游戏的视觉体验。
  • 性能优化:通过优化游戏性能,提升游戏的运行效率。

PG电子APP的未来趋势

随着技术的不断进步和市场需求的变化,PG电子APP的未来发展趋势将更加多元化,以下是几个值得期待的未来趋势:

AI 技术的深度应用

AI技术的深度应用将为PG电子APP带来更多的可能性,包括:

  • 智能AI 机器人:通过AI技术实现智能AI机器人,提升游戏的可玩性。
  • 动态场景生成:通过AI技术实现动态场景的生成,提升游戏的趣味性。
  • 个性化的游戏体验:通过AI技术实现个性化游戏体验,提升玩家的满意度。

AR/VR 技术的结合

AR/VR技术的结合将为PG电子APP带来全新的体验,包括:

  • AR 游戏:通过AR技术实现沉浸式的游戏体验,玩家可以通过手机或平板电脑进行游戏。
  • VR 游戏:通过VR技术实现身临其境的游戏体验,玩家可以完全沉浸在游戏世界中。
  • 混合现实:通过混合现实技术实现AR与VR的结合,玩家可以同时体验两种不同的游戏体验。

的多元化

的多元化将为PG电子APP带来更多的可能性,包括:

  • 横版游戏:通过横版游戏的设计,提升游戏的可玩性和趣味性。
  • 角色扮演:通过角色扮演的游戏,提升玩家的代入感和互动性。
  • 休闲游戏:通过休闲游戏的设计,满足不同玩家的需求,提升游戏的粘性。

PG电子APP开发是一项复杂而富有挑战性的任务,需要技术团队和开发者的共同努力,从概念到落地,PG电子APP的开发过程充满了艰辛和挑战,但也充满了机遇和可能性,通过不断的创新和优化,PG电子APP一定能够为玩家带来更加精彩的游戏体验。

PG电子APP开发,从概念到落地实践pg电子APP开发,

发表评论